Mirror Grinding ...Light Weight Telescope Mirror Blanks and Lens Blanks | Telescope Mirror and Lens Technology | Corning · To avoid astigmatism of thin mirrors and ordinary lenses rotate them frequently. I do after every wet. Thin mirror blanks need to be ground flat on the back and their wedge removed before working on the mirror surface itself.Experiments to measure the focal length of a converging lens. Method (1). Cool Crowdfunding: Tabletop Cities, Robot Arms, and Bots.Fine grinding refines the basic shape you have ground into the surface of the glass with rough grinding. The sequence of ever finer grits that you use smoothes the rough surface that was made in rough grinding, and prepares you for polishing.Grinding action of a ... as the lap is moved over the surface of the mirror, the glass surface ...
